Learn more about Teleport here: teleport.it Looking for a strategic logistics professional responsible for the truck vendor management, planning trucks based on cost optimization model by also balancing SLA requirements. Their primary goal is to ensure availability of trucks for first mile,mid mile and last mile pick ups ,and achieve maximum cost-efficiency A DAY IN A LIFE Operational Planning & Scheduling: Develop and optimize adhoc/fixed job allocation to the vendors by taking in account of the vendor capacity,cost optimization and defined optimum capacity utilization Key Performance Indicator Management: Establish and oversee both internal team member and external vendors KPIs, Take necessary action/escalate if the KPI is not being met on daily/weekly/monthly basis Cost Control & Budgeting: Manage the fleet budget by implementing processes to ensure the right truck size is being deployed based on the forecast requirement and vendors are being activated based on their cost. Regulatory Compliance: Ensure all truck planning are being done by taking in account of local regulatory requirements - (Peak hours roadbans, Festive season roadbans etc). To have major experience in Malaysia regulations, (Indonesia, Thailand, Philiphines, India would be an added advantage) Team Management: Recruit, train, and supervise a team of 6-8 person to collectively achieve departmental goals Process and Work flow : To be able to design process and work instructions for the team members within a short span of time based on changing business needs. (Draw.io experience would be an added advantage) Data Analysis & Technology: Utilize Transport Management Software (TMS) and available data sets for analysis and continuous improvement on the decision making. To be able to analyze truck movement timestamp and other set of datas for cost optimization and reduce the risk on operations. Minimum 5 years experience with atleast 3 years on managerial role Posses at least Degree in Logistics/Tranport Management or any relevant related studies Should be flexible to travel based on business requirements Should be able to have flexible working hours upon business requirement Have experience in industry standard Transport Management System Proficiency in Google Sheets/Microsoft Excel is a must Proficiency in Looker Studio would be an added advantage
